Phu Quoc makes top list of Asia's cheapest flight destinations for 2026

Phu Quoc ranked 4th among the top 10 best value flight destinations for 2026, according to the UK-based travel search and price comparison platform Skyscanner.

According to the "Cheapest Destinations 2026" report, published on 22/1, Phu Quoc is Vietnam's sole representative among destinations offering the most reasonable economy round-trip airfares for 2026.

The list was compiled based on actual search and booking data from 2025, aggregated from millions of monthly visits to the Skyscanner platform.

Phu Quoc's inclusion among destinations with competitive flight costs, alongside established beach tourism spots like Phuket (Thailand), Manila (Philippines), and Denpasar (Indonesia), indicates the Pearl Island is improving its regional and international air accessibility.

Beyond its appearance in the cost ranking, Phu Quoc also features among next year's trending destinations.

According to Skyscanner's "Trending Destinations 2026" report, Phu Quoc ranks second globally for flight search growth, achieving 184% compared to the previous year. Skyscanner identifies Phu Quoc as ideal for relaxing getaways due to its natural landscapes, beaches, and tranquil environment.

Tourism experts suggest these results reflect the impact of visa policy and transportation infrastructure. Phu Quoc is currently Vietnam's only locality offering a 30-day visa exemption for international visitors. Furthermore, the island's domestic and international flight network continues to expand, enhancing accessibility for foreign tourists.

In 2025, Phu Quoc welcomed approximately 8,3 million visitors, exceeding its target by 18%. International visitors reached nearly 1,9 million, almost doubling year-on-year. This growth continued into the first month of 2026, with the number of international flights to Phu Quoc airport increasing by about 40% compared to the same period last year.

Phu Quoc's consistent presence in Skyscanner's reputable rankings demonstrates that it is not merely benefiting from trends, but is building a sustainable competitive advantage based on reasonable access costs and an increasingly comprehensive experience ecosystem. The island is gaining popularity among international visitors due to unique experiences like the sea-crossing cable car, fireworks displays twice nightly in the southern district, and the iconic Kiss Bridge.

As airfares become "an open door" to attract global tourists, and experiences become the reason for their return, Phu Quoc is steadily positioning itself as one of the world's most notable beach destinations for 2026.
